The project aims at connection the activities from several fields of forestry education and research. We plan to use most advanced technology. The forest growth simulator SIBYLA, which has been developed by Fabrika (2005) at the Technical University in Zvolen, will be used as a main tool. The detailed field measurements of photosynthetic activity and actual meteorological data will be used for modeling of forest growth. This will allow to validate the model of photosynthesis in the simulator. Such simulation has a great importance not only in the research, but also in visualization during an education process. The precision of the model should be enhanced due to which in can also be used in future research.
